
This school year, the Johnson City Middle School participated in a whole school book reading opportunity. Following the model of One School, One Book, the entire middle school staff and student body read "The Season of Styx Malone" by author Kekla Magoon. This award-winning novel tells the story of three young boys, brothers Caleb and Bobby Gene and their friend Styx Malone, a cool newcomer in their small town. Each student and staff member received their own copy of the book. Students engaged in book discussions, trivia, and even had the opportunity to listen to staff-recorded videos of the book.
On October 26, the entire middle school held a virtual assembly with the author. She talked about the wide-ranging inspirations for her books, the demands and discipline required to be an author, the common theme of a character wanting to make a difference in her stories and, of course, “The Season of Styx Malone.”
